Sighs of the Highland Wind
by Olivia Kerr
Every sunset over the loch whispers their names.
Dive into the heart of the Scottish Highlands with this stirring collection of tales where fierce passion, undying love, and breathtaking adventure collide against the backdrop of Scotland’s majestic landscapes. Each story in this enchanting trilogy weaves a tale of intense emotion, profound romance, and the enduring strength of the heart.
Books included:
The Laird’s Scarred Servant
In the halls of McDonald castle, a love as unexpected as it is forbidden blossoms. Maxwell Forbes, the heir of his clan turned penniless wanderer, finds sanctuary in the compassionate care of Kenna Bowie, a servant with eyes as captivating as her spirit. Hidden in the shadows, their love grows amidst a web of secrets and lies. Will the truth break their entwined hearts, or will love overpower adversity?
Fooled by the Illegitimate Highlander
Cameron, born a bastard but destined to lead, faces an impossible choice between his heart’s desire and his duty to the clan. His love and devotion for Ava now hangs by a thread, threatened by a marriage not of love, but of convenience. In this game of love and loyalty, Cameron and Ava’s hearts wrestle with a cruel fate. In the end, will duty extinguish the flame that burns between them?
To Love a Highland Rebel
Norah Brown’s heart bears the scars of a love lost, her dreams shattered when Tearlach chose rebellion over their future. Their paths cross once more, rekindling a love that never truly died. But with danger out to get them, Norah stands at a crossroads: protect her heart or risk it all for the man who owns it. Can their love be the beacon that will guide them through the storm?
The Highlanders’ fervent passions and unbreakable spirits echo the wild beauty of the land they call home. Embrace the call of the Highlands and surrender to the allure of timeless romance, letting these stirring tales of love fill your heart.

Olivia Kerr's Sighs of the Highland Wind is a captivating trilogy that transports readers to the rugged and romantic landscapes of the Scottish Highlands. Through its three interconnected stories, Kerr masterfully weaves themes of love, loyalty, and resilience, painting a vivid picture of the human heart's capacity to endure and triumph over adversity. Each tale is a testament to the timeless allure of romance, set against the backdrop of Scotland's majestic beauty.
The first story, The Laird’s Scarred Servant, introduces us to Maxwell Forbes and Kenna Bowie, two characters whose lives are intricately entwined by fate and circumstance. Maxwell, once the heir of his clan, finds himself a penniless wanderer, seeking refuge in the halls of McDonald castle. It is here that he encounters Kenna, a servant whose compassionate nature and captivating spirit breathe life into his weary soul. Kerr's portrayal of their forbidden love is both tender and poignant, as they navigate a web of secrets and lies that threaten to tear them apart. The author skillfully explores the theme of love's resilience, questioning whether truth will shatter their bond or if love can indeed conquer all.
In Fooled by the Illegitimate Highlander, Kerr delves into the complexities of duty and desire. Cameron, born a bastard yet destined to lead, faces an impossible choice between his heart's longing and his obligations to the clan. His love for Ava is palpable, yet it hangs precariously by a thread, threatened by a marriage of convenience. Kerr's exploration of love and loyalty is both heart-wrenching and thought-provoking, as Cameron and Ava grapple with a cruel fate. The narrative raises poignant questions about the sacrifices one must make for love and whether duty can truly extinguish the flame that burns between two souls.
The final tale, To Love a Highland Rebel, brings us the story of Norah Brown and Tearlach, whose love is rekindled amidst the chaos of rebellion. Norah's heart bears the scars of a love lost, yet when Tearlach reenters her life, the embers of their passion are reignited. Kerr's depiction of their reunion is both exhilarating and fraught with danger, as Norah must decide whether to protect her heart or risk it all for the man who owns it. The narrative beautifully captures the theme of love as a guiding beacon, capable of leading two souls through the storm of life.
Throughout the trilogy, Kerr's character development is both nuanced and compelling. Each protagonist is richly drawn, with their own distinct personalities and motivations. Maxwell's transformation from a wanderer to a man in love is both believable and heartwarming, while Kenna's strength and compassion make her a truly memorable heroine. Cameron's internal struggle between duty and desire is portrayed with depth and sensitivity, and Ava's unwavering devotion adds a layer of emotional complexity to their story. Norah and Tearlach's journey is equally captivating, as they navigate the tumultuous waters of love and rebellion.
Kerr's writing is imbued with a lyrical quality that enhances the overall impact of the stories. Her descriptions of the Scottish Highlands are nothing short of breathtaking, capturing the wild beauty of the land and its influence on the characters' lives. The author's ability to evoke emotion through her prose is a testament to her skill as a storyteller, drawing readers into the world she has created and allowing them to experience the characters' joys and sorrows as their own.
In comparison to other works in the genre, Sighs of the Highland Wind stands out for its rich character development and exploration of complex themes. While reminiscent of Diana Gabaldon's Outlander series in its setting and romantic elements, Kerr's trilogy offers a unique perspective on the enduring power of love amidst the challenges of life. The stories are both timeless and contemporary, appealing to readers who appreciate romance with depth and substance.
Overall, Sighs of the Highland Wind is a beautifully crafted collection of tales that will resonate with fans of historical romance and those who appreciate stories of love's triumph over adversity. Olivia Kerr has created a world that is both enchanting and emotionally resonant, inviting readers to lose themselves in the passion and adventure of the Scottish Highlands. This trilogy is a testament to the enduring strength of the heart and the timeless allure of romance, making it a must-read for anyone seeking a captivating and heartfelt journey.
